What Are Prefabricated Modular Data Centers?
Definition and Concept of Modular Data Centers
Modular data centers are pre-engineered, factory-built systems that may be quickly erected and deployed in a variety of locations. Unlike typical data centers, these modular systems are built for scalability and flexibility, with components pre-assembled in a controlled setting. Key Components of HUAWEI’s Modular Data Centers
HUAWEI’s modular data centers, like the FusionDC1000C, consist of several key components, including server racks, cooling systems, power distribution units, and security systems. These components are intended for simple integration, allowing for rapid and efficient deployment. The prefabrication rate of up to 90% assures that these units are ready for use with little on-site building, considerably decreasing the time necessary to establish a working data center.H3: Advantages Over Traditional Data Centers
Prefabricated modular data centers have significant benefits over conventional brick-and-mortar alternatives. The main advantages include speedier deployment, increased scalability, and cheaper capital cost. Companies that achieve a greater prefabrication rate, such as HUAWEI’s FusionDC1000C, may put up data centers in a fraction of the time it would take to establish a standard facility. Furthermore, modular designs are more energy-efficient and adaptable to future demands, making them an affordable option for enterprises of all sizes.
